计算机技术问题分为两类,一类是人为制定的技术,另一类是自然法则。“vs2010如何给所有项目进行一次性配置”——这属于人为技术问题,"C++的虚函数是什么”--这也是人为技术问题。“既要快速插入,又要快速查找,该选择什么数据结构”——这属于自然法则。人为技术问题如果没有类似解决经验的话,无法通过思考...
分类:
其他 时间:
2014-12-30 09:53:36
收藏:
0 评论:
0 赞:
0 阅读:
255
js-dom1、input type="button" value="单击" onclick="document.onchick=f1" function f1(){ aleat("f1"); } “document.oncick=f1”中"f1"未加“()”,加了“()”表示立即...
分类:
其他 时间:
2014-12-30 09:53:26
收藏:
0 评论:
0 赞:
0 阅读:
270
#region U盘监测 public const int WM_DEVICECHANGE = 0x219; public const int DBT_DEVICEARRIVAL = 0x8000; public const int DBT_DEVICER...
分类:
其他 时间:
2014-12-30 09:53:06
收藏:
0 评论:
0 赞:
0 阅读:
228
1. Referencehttp://www.shubhro.com/2014/12/27/software-engineers-should-write/2. srcIn elementary school, there were “math kids” and there were “Engli...
分类:
其他 时间:
2014-12-30 09:52:56
收藏:
0 评论:
0 赞:
0 阅读:
233
Apache Synapse 是一个简单、轻量级的高性能企业服务总线 (ESB),它是在 Apache Software Foundation 的 Apache License Version 2.0 下发布的。使用 Apache Synapse,您可以通过 HTTP、HTTPS、Java? Mes...
分类:
Web开发 时间:
2014-12-30 09:52:46
收藏:
0 评论:
0 赞:
0 阅读:
361
iOS 数据库操作(使用FMDB) iOS中原生的SQLite API在使用上相当不友好,在使用时,非常不便。于是,就出现了一系列将SQLite API进行封装的库,例如FMDB、PlausibleDatabase、sqlitepersistentobjects等,FMDB (https://...
分类:
移动平台 时间:
2014-12-30 09:52:36
收藏:
0 评论:
0 赞:
0 阅读:
368
Python中的构造函数是形如def__init__(self),例如classBird:
def__init__(self):
self.hungry=True
defeat(self):
ifself.hungry:
print‘Ahhhh‘
self.hungry=False
else:
print‘no,thx‘
实例化类Bird对象b:
b=Bird()
b.eat()
b.eat()
Ahhhh
no,thx假设现在Bird有一个子类So..
分类:
编程语言 时间:
2014-12-30 09:18:53
收藏:
0 评论:
0 赞:
0 阅读:
328
1、判断整数串。//判断CString是否为数字串
BOOLisDigitalCString(constCString&cstr)
{
returncstr==cstr.SpanIncluding(_T("0123456789"));
}参考:一、二。***walker*2014-12-30***
分类:
编程语言 时间:
2014-12-30 09:18:43
收藏:
0 评论:
0 赞:
0 阅读:
183
题目描述
小黑办了个美术学校,由于上年办的那个班反响不错,所以他今年扩招到3个班,他想了解一下他办的这个班是对女生更有吸引力还是对男生更有吸引力,当然他还想知道到底招了多少人!快来帮帮小黑吧,你需要计算女生占的比例,男生占的比例 ,包括占各班的,占全校的,以及各班总人数和总招收的人数。
输入
共三个班,分别输入各班男生,女生的个数
输出
先输出各班...
分类:
其他 时间:
2014-12-30 09:17:52
收藏:
0 评论:
0 赞:
0 阅读:
142
本文是在学习中的总结,欢迎转载但请注明出处:http://blog.csdn.net/pistolove/article/details/42261333
在上一篇文章中介绍了“提炼函数“。本文将介绍“内联函数”这种重构手法。
下面让我们一起来学习该重构手法把。...
分类:
其他 时间:
2014-12-30 09:17:42
收藏:
0 评论:
0 赞:
0 阅读:
254
总结一下我在工作中用的比较多的一些Maven命令.
1. mvn clean
2.mvn package
3.mvn dependency:tree
4.mvn dependency:copy-dependencies
5.mvn dependency:ananlyze...
分类:
其他 时间:
2014-12-30 09:17:32
收藏:
0 评论:
0 赞:
0 阅读:
304
1、 一个项目里可以有多张分立的原理图。
2、 一项目里多张分立的原理图不能单独分开分别导入不同的PCB,导入一个PCB时同一
项目所有原理图一定是个集体,并一定会一起同时导入这个PCB,也就是一个PCB一定包含这个项目所有原理图。但可以画多张PCB。
3、 当原理图张数或电路改变时,重新导入PCB后,会使PCB更新至和已有原理图一致,
当在PCB改变了位号时更新原理图,在原理图重新编...
分类:
其他 时间:
2014-12-30 09:17:07
收藏:
0 评论:
0 赞:
0 阅读:
308
FluentNHibernate之所以替代NHibernate并不仅仅是因为对Mapping配置文件的优化,另外它换可以优化数据库的链接xml以及规避Mapping文件的编写,这种完全自动化的编程方法就是AutoMapping,FluentNHibernate封装了自动化映射的方法,使得开发人员只需要几种到对Table的修改中,而不需要考虑数据模型到对象模型的转化过程。...
分类:
移动平台 时间:
2014-12-30 09:16:52
收藏:
0 评论:
0 赞:
0 阅读:
497
PCB库的绘制
注意:画完元件封装要设置参考点,按E再按F,通常设一脚为参考点,便于PCB绘制时拖动。
1、 在PCB裤环境,如果多条线或多个焊盘叠在一起,如果你要选中某条线或焊盘删除,
则直接单击,并选择,就可以直接删除,如果你要选出某条线或焊盘移动,则点击不动,选择然后即可移动。
2、 在PCB库环境如果想同时移动多条组合线,则需先选择多条线,然后按M,接着按S
即可将多条线组...
分类:
其他 时间:
2014-12-30 09:16:42
收藏:
0 评论:
0 赞:
0 阅读:
553
javascript对大小写敏感(关键字、函数名、变量名等),标识符的首字符必须是字母、下划线或者$符,其后的字符可以含数字
如果之声明了变量,并未对其赋值,默认为undefined
javascript中不区分整型和浮点型,所有数字都是用浮点型表示的
字符串型包含在单引号或者双引号内
转义字符
转义序列 字符
/b 退格
/f 换页
/n...
分类:
编程语言 时间:
2014-12-30 09:16:32
收藏:
0 评论:
0 赞:
0 阅读:
144
方法二:(避免建立多规则复杂)适用方法
在规则里设定安全间距,此规则对ALL适用
a、如果铺铜需更小安全间距,则直接把规则间距减小,然后按第18的方法对某个区域选中铺通即可,其他铺铜安全间距不影响不报错。b、如果铺铜需更大安全间距,则把规则间距改大,PCB铺铜报错,然后按第18的方法对某个区域选中铺通,铺完后再把规则改小返回即报错消失如a。
总结:安全间距规则改小可直接铺铜,规则...
分类:
其他 时间:
2014-12-30 09:16:22
收藏:
0 评论:
0 赞:
0 阅读:
502
题目大意:给定一张无向图,求从s出发恰好经过n条边到达e的最短路
倍增Floyd……为何大家都管这个叫做矩阵乘法- - 算了为何要纠结这种事- -
令f[p][i][j]表示走2^p步从i到达j的最短路 有f[p][i][j]=min{f[p-1][i][k]+f[p-1][k][j]}
将n进行二进制拆分 用矩阵g记录答案矩阵 对于每一位p 用f[p]和g两个矩阵搞出h 再将h的值赋给g
...
分类:
其他 时间:
2014-12-30 09:16:12
收藏:
0 评论:
0 赞:
0 阅读:
496
题目大意:求恰好走k步从S到T的最短路。
思路:设f[p][i][j]为从i到j恰好走2^p步的最短路,DP方程十分简单:f[p][i][j] = min(f[p][i][j],f[p - 1][i][k] + f[p - 1][k][j]);
对总步数T进行二进制拆分,在T有1的位置上,假如这个位置为p,那么就用f[p][][]来更新答案g[][],最后得到的g[][]就是答案矩阵。...
分类:
其他 时间:
2014-12-30 09:16:02
收藏:
0 评论:
0 赞:
0 阅读:
298
1. yum install subversion #安装svn2. groupadd svn #为运行svn设置专用的用户组,非必须操作,但推荐3. useradd -g svn svn #为运行svn设置专用的用户,非必须操作,但推荐4. passwd svn #为运行svn专用用户设置密码,非必须操作,但推荐5. mkdir -p /var/svn #建立/var/svn...
分类:
系统服务 时间:
2014-12-30 09:15:52
收藏:
0 评论:
0 赞:
0 阅读:
296
一个应用程序当中通常都会包含很多个Activity,每个Activity都应该设计成为一个具有特定的功能,并且可以让用户进行操作的组件。另外,Activity之间还应该是可以相互启动的。比如,一个邮件应用中可能会包含一个用于展示邮件列表的Activity,而当用户点击了其中某一封邮件的时候,就会打开另外一个Activity来显示该封邮件的具体内容。
除此之外,一个Activity甚至还可以去启动其它应用程序当中的Activity。打个比方,如果你的应用希望去发送一封邮件,你就可以定义一个具有"send"动作...
分类:
移动平台 时间:
2014-12-30 09:15:42
收藏:
0 评论:
0 赞:
0 阅读:
498